Just wondering if a minimal change to

if (atom.config.get('sync-settings.installLatestVersion')) {
pkg.version = null
} else if (pkg.apmInstallSource) {
pkg.name = pkg.apmInstallSource.source
pkg.version = null
}
would be enough...

Something like this :

if (atom.config.get('sync-settings.installLatestVersion')) {
  pkg.version = null
}
if (pkg.apmInstallSource) {
  pkg.name = pkg.apmInstallSource.source
  pkg.version = null
}

I'll test it and give results here.
